Q1. In what ways does your media product use,develop or challenge forms and conventions of real media products?
MASTHEAD
• The masthead is the largest part on my cover and covers the top half of
my page; as I want this to stand out to the reader so that they recognize
my brand and the name of the magazine. A pink drop shadow is used
behind the black writing to contrast and come out more especially as the
background is light.
• I used the colours black and pink as they balance each other out as well
as the two colours contrasting against each other; I also wanted it to
apply to my target audience which is both male and female so instead of
sticking to one specific colour I chose two.
• It is layered on top of the artist’s instead of beneath as although the
artist’s do stand out as this is also one of the vocal points of the magazine
as the name makes a statement.
Cover Image
• Both artists are making eye contact with the
camera (audience) in order to make a
connection with the reader as it grabs
attention once you’ve recognized eye
contact.
• The artist is placed on the centre of the front
page and covers the width of the page the
artists are wearing opposite colours “black
and white” to contrast against each other.
• I’ve increased both the vibrance and
brightness so that the reflection of the light
enhances the artist and makes them stand
off against the white background.
• Both artist are stood face on slightly standing
to the side, as well as leaning on each other
to incorporate that they are not individual
artists but work together.
Headline
• This is also one of the main fonts on the page and also one of the largest; it
simply states the name of the two artists so that the reader can tell who the
main accent of the magazine, this will entice the reader to carry on reading the
magazine further to know what the artists are about and why they are such a
main feature of the magazine.
• The headline is positioned about ¾ below the page and sits fairy to the middle of
the artists, I used to same font styles and colours that were used on the
masthead to dramatise the importance of the celebrities just as much as the
importance of the magazine itself, the font is the same as my masthead because I
feel that it would make a statement.
• The pull quote follows just below the headline to give an insight of what the
artists are bout without revealing too much information, It is intriguing the
reader to reading the article as it says a lot without being to informative.
• This is still following the conventions of a magazine cover.
Straplines
• This is located at the bottom of the page beneath the masthead, cover
image and headlines instead of at the top where this is usually placed on a
magazine.
• This adds something extra to the magazine rather than just articles it’s a
chance for the reader to win something, which also engages the reader to
the magazine as the magazine itself includes more than one thing and
features more than one celebrity. The font is also the same as both the
masthead and headline as its bold and stands out more than other
headlines so that these are the first things that appeal to the reader.
• The font is also in upper case letters to make it stand out more as it’s a
unique offer for the reader to take part in.
coverlines
• I have 2 coverlines both aligned to the left and
right of the page margins, leaving a slight gap
between the edges of the page so that no
writing is cut off. Both of my coverlines are
positioned different one closer to the top of
the page and one further down making sure
that none of the text is covering the artists
faces as these were the main focal point of the
magazine and the selling point of the
magazine as this I what should first appeal to
the reader.
• Some of the writing is in capital letters to make
it stand out from the rest a text as this is what
should draw in the reader as it’s defined
making it stand out more.
• The writing below this is still used with the
same font as the the masthead but with lower
case letters to correspond from what I want to
stand out more e.g; the artists names.
contents
Column layout
• The contents page has only one
column which features all the
information for the contents of
the magazine. This includes a
brief description about what
each feature entails
• Used pull quotes underneath
each section of the column to
summarily explain what each
article is about without
revealing to much to the reader,
as I want them to feel intrigued
into reading my magazine rather
than knowing everything jus
from first look of a page.
• The contents page contains
an image of the two artists
that were on the front cover
of the magazine to
emphasise the importance of
them both. As well as having
their feature on the top of
the list of the contents page.
• The layer of the image is
place above the shape of the
column to make them stand
out more but beneath the
text, the text also changes
from black and white
depending of the position of
the back ground e.g; on the
black part of the image the
text colour is changed to
white so both the image and
text contrast against each
other to stand out.
Article
Columns for body text
• All the text is printed on the first page to allow
both the artists featured to appear fully on the
second page.
• The text is also over layed on top of another
photos of the artists which is slightly faded
which makes both the image and and text
visible. The body of the text is split into three
separate columns.
• The background image shows through all the
text to enhance both the text and images as
well as making them both stand out
proportionally.
headline
• This is placed near the top of the page off to the side just beneath the title of the
artists name.
• Used different colours to highlight the importance of the text ‘THE NEW FACE OF
R&B” the word FACE is in black writing to emphasise that my artists define the
R&B genre as that is what I want the readers to believe.
Lead in
• ‘we’re constantly hearing about ‘the one to
watch’ and today this phrase couldn’t be more
apparent.
• This is positioned below the the title but next to
the headline; it is a brief description about the
purpose of my article so that this can captivate
the readers eye just as they begin to read the
article.
• In italics to make it stand out from the rest as its
using a different text format.
Footer
A red box positioned beneath the image across the spread of a double page,it
includes the page numbers and the names of how to access the magazine
online; twitter,instagram and facebook.
Pull quote
• Placed on the opposite page to
the article.
• On top of the image with the
opacity being taken down
slightly so that the both the pull
quote and image are still visible.
• Decided to place this quote
between the two artists faces to
make it clear it has came from
them this also looks effective as
it makes both the quote and
image stand out more.
Photoshoot image
• The main photoshoot image covers
the whole spread of the second
page.
• Both artists have a head shot with
only one half of the faces showing
bringing more attention to the eyes
as if they are concerntrating on the
reader.
• The studio image was taken at a
headshot using each half of the
face.
• The pull quote is placed exactly in
the middle of the space between
both artists heads.
Developing ideas
Front cover
• Most of the conventions I have used on my front cover are developed
from the ‘vibe’ magazine from this particular issue. I used some of the
same names of artists from the vibe magazine onto my own as my
magazine is specified to the R&B genre so by using these names of
artists like Drake and Chris Brown so that the reader can recognise
what my magazine is about.
• I used the same idea by having a massive bold font but developed this
as I used uppercase letters whereas the vibe magazine uses a variation
of both upper and lower case letters. I also used the colour black
instead of white and used a pink drop shadow to make the text bounce
off the page more, both texts are bold and use sharp edges so that it
makes more of a statement by standing out.
• I also positioned my cover lines on either sides of the margins the same
as VIBE magazine which makes it look a little similar but decided to not
use as many as the other
Contents page
• The column layout on my contents
page only includes one which is
aligned to the left hand side of the
margins.
• They are split into separate sections to
tell that it’s a break to a new page.
• The feature image is positioned
infront of the box instead of behind,
but still beneath the text.
• This idea was developed from the vibe
magazine also but using a different
issue.
Article
Elements have been copied and
developed from the particular issue of
billboard magazine featuring Nicki Minaj.
I have used three separate columns on
my article and had the first letter
highlighted in the colour pink in bold text.
A pull quote insert is used at the top of
the page beneath the artists name,
instead of on top like the billboard issue.
The position of the headline is placed at
the top of the page in the colour pink also
with a black drop shadow, changed from
the billboard issue as this is beneath the
quote/ headline with just the colour pink,
this font is thinner compared to the one
used in billboard.
Quotes of what the artists have said are in
bold and break down the start of a new
topic.
Image covers one half of the page with
text wrapped between it.
Challenging ideas of my front cover
I have decided to use a footer but not to include
all the different feature inside this magazine but
to promote my magazine by offering something
for the audience to take part in e.g; a
competition. To the direct the reader eye to this
particular part of the magazine as well as the
headline
Challenging ideas of my contents page
Instead of having a variety of columns and
photographs I decided to use one column
and one image, to draw attention more the
the two feature artists rather than
everything else inside the magazine,
although this too should stand out the
main feature of me magazine is the article
so this is to make a bolder statement by
repeating the image.
Challenging ideas of my article
The pull quote is placed between
both pages rather than fit to one
page in a medium font size to stand
out from the rest of the text but not
as large as the headline.
Using an image of the artists
beneath the text as a background to
promote the artists even more as
there Is an image of them n both
pages to make them stand out more
towards the reader.
